1、解压下载得到的nginx-1.8.0.zip。
2、直接双击nginx.exe启动或者进入命令提示符(cmd),进入文件目录,输入start nignx回车。
3、命令
start nginx 启动
nginx -s stop 停止(快速停止)
nginx -s quit 停止(完整有序的停止并保存相关信息)
nginx -s reload 重新载入配置文件
nginx -s reopen 重新打开日志文件
4、监听端口 listen 8800
5、目录地址配置
location / {
root D:\\nginx\\html;
index index.html index.htm;
}
6、多虚拟主机 取消另一个server的注释,监听另一个接口
7、反向代理,负载均衡(nginx+2tomcat)
upstream localhost {
#ip_hash;如果不注释则为同一个IP只访问同一个tomcat
server localhost:7080;
server localhost:7081;
}
server {
listen 8088;
server_name localhost;
location / {
proxy_pass http://localhost;
location /media {
root D:\\nginx\\;
expires 1h;
2、直接双击nginx.exe启动或者进入命令提示符(cmd),进入文件目录,输入start nignx回车。
3、命令
start nginx 启动
nginx -s stop 停止(快速停止)
nginx -s quit 停止(完整有序的停止并保存相关信息)
nginx -s reload 重新载入配置文件
nginx -s reopen 重新打开日志文件
4、监听端口 listen 8800
5、目录地址配置
location / {
root D:\\nginx\\html;
index index.html index.htm;
}
6、多虚拟主机 取消另一个server的注释,监听另一个接口
7、反向代理,负载均衡(nginx+2tomcat)
upstream localhost {
#ip_hash;如果不注释则为同一个IP只访问同一个tomcat
server localhost:7080;
server localhost:7081;
}
server {
listen 8088;
server_name localhost;
location / {
proxy_pass http://localhost;
}
如何同时启动多个tomcat,请参考:
http://blog.163.com/cup1987@yeah/blog/static/114884719201010310450980/ 大概意思为修改三个端口号http连接端口,shutdown接口,还有jvm启动端口
关键字搜索:启动多个tomcat
8、动静分离
location /media {
root D:\\nginx\\;
expires 1h;
}
9、资源链接
http://nginx.org/en/download.html nginx下载,建议选择稳定版本
http://tomcat.apache.org/download-70.cgi 服务器选择服务器安装版本,非服务器选择解压版本即可(注意:解压绿色版本不会创建service,故bin下tomcat.exe和tomcatw.exe不会启动,想要可用,cmd到bin文件夹下,service.bat即可注册服务。与安装版本有所不同,不会在开始菜单创建tomcat,当右下角exit tomcatw.exe时,安装版本可以在开始菜单monitortomcat重启小图标,而绿色版本不会)